In the immediate town center stands the community center, built around 1900, renovated and converted by the municipality in 1986. Until the 1960s, the current community center housed one of four inns in Alsdorf. The landlady, known to everyone only as "Wagnersch Oma", was legendary. Today it is the living room of Alsdorf. Used by local clubs and groups as a meeting and practice room, it also serves the local council as a regular meeting room. The community center is also gladly rented for private celebrations. The local youth club is also housed in the basement. Of the originally four inns in the town, the Gasthof Hellertal remains. The building is owned by the municipality and is leased. The hall, which can hold up to 100 people, is unique in the surrounding area and is often used for events and celebrations. Other facilities in the municipality include the Hellertal primary school with the gymnasium built right next to it, two daycare centers built directly on the village park, the "Alte Schule" (Old School) built in 1866, which today houses a small commercial enterprise, and a small shopping center including a gas station at the edge of the town towards Herdorf. Some industrial and craft businesses, which are also internationally active and among the market leaders in their sector, as well as some retail companies, are located in Alsdorf and offer jobs for the town. ...

... The first mention of Alsdorf dates back to 1248. At that time, a nobleman named "Wilhelm vom Amilardisdorp" was mentioned as a witness in a deed of gift to the Marienstatt monastery. A copy of this document is now kept in the Alsdorfer Bürgerhaus. The first settlements to be mentioned are primarily the area in front of the Arsberg and the Alsberg. In these areas, the still recognizable core of Alsdorf developed with its distinctive half-timbered houses. The designation "Hölzerne Ecke" (Wooden Corner) indicates this. The third settlement area was in the Imhäuser Hof. The owners of the farm called themselves "von Imhausen". Forests, meadows, and pastures were used cooperatively by the settlers at that time. The origins of the still existing Hauberg cooperatives "Arsberg", "Alsberg", and "Imhausen" are traced back to this. Alsdorf was one of the most commercially active places in the Oberkreis until the mid-19th century. Agriculture with the typical Hauberg economy, mining, and ironworks were the most important pillars of economic activity. In 1885, the fires of the ironworks, which had made Alsdorf an important and prosperous place in previous centuries, were extinguished. A sawmill was later built on the site in the town center, which fell victim to a major fire in 1972. The "Hüttenmauer" (Foundry Wall) built in 1985 from rubble stone towards Kirchstraße and an information board still commemorate the former foundry operated at this location. Particularly worth seeing are the well-preserved and partly lovingly restored half-timbered houses located mainly in the town center. The "Hüttenschulzehaus", known beyond the town and one of the best-preserved half-timbered houses in Alsdorf. Built in 1680 on the terrace of the Arsberg, one of the first settlement areas in the town, the house, which is now a listed building, housed the so-called Hüttenschulze for many decades. He was the administrator and operational manager of the foundry. He also managed the foundry's cash box. The office of Hüttenschulze was once coveted, as it was associated with a lucrative salary in addition to the high prestige of the officeholder. The Druidensteig trail leads directly past it. ...

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available around Niederdreisbach?

There are nearly 180 road cycling routes around Niederdreisbach, offering a wide variety of options for different skill levels and preferences. The komoot community has explored over 170 routes in the area.

What kind of terrain can I expect on road cycling routes in Niederdreisbach?

The Niederdreisbach area, part of the Westerwald-Sieg region, features a diverse landscape of green meadows, dense forests, and rolling hills. You'll encounter idyllic river valleys and wooded hills, providing a mix of challenging ascents and more leisurely paths. This varied terrain ensures a dynamic cycling experience.

Are there routes suitable for beginners or less experienced road cyclists?

Yes, Niederdreisbach offers routes for all skill levels. While many routes are moderate, there are 13 easy routes available, perfect for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ed ride. These routes allow you to enjoy the scenic beauty without overly strenuous climbs.

What are some notable natural features or landmarks to look out for on a ride?

Road cycling routes around Niederdreisbach often pass by interesting natural features and landmarks. You might encounter the striking Druid's Stone, a basalt cone visible from afar, or enjoy panoramic views from observation towers like the Otto Tower or Pfannenbergturm. For a scenic break, consider routes that pass by lakes such as Elkenrother Weiher or Rosenheimer Lay Basalt Lake.

Are there any circular road cycling routes in the Niederdreisbach area?

Many of the road cycling routes around Niederdreisbach are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. For example, the View of Freusburg Castle – Freusburg Mill loop from Biersdorf-Ort(Ww) is a popular circular route offering scenic views, and the View of the Siebengebirge – Elkenrother Weiher loop from Weitefeld also provides a great circular option.

What do other road cyclists say about the routes in Niederdreisbach?

The road cycling routes in Niederdreisbach are highly regarded by the komoot community, holding an average rating of 4.5 stars from over 400 reviews. Cyclists frequently praise the region's picturesque landscapes, the variety of routes, and the well-maintained paths that make for an enjoyable experience.

Can I find routes with significant elevation gain for a more challenging ride?

Absolutely. The rolling hills of the Westerwald-Sieg region provide ample opportunities for challenging climbs. There are 56 difficult routes available, with some offering substantial elevation gain. For instance, the Wisserbach Riverside Landscape – Mühlental loop from Daaden features over 800 meters of ascent, perfect for experienced riders seeking a demanding workout.

Are there any routes that pass by historical sites or cultural attractions?

While primarily known for its natural beauty, the region does offer cultural points of interest. Some routes may pass near sites like Marienstatt Abbey or the Schieferbergwerk (slate mine). Additionally, you might find historical shelters or restaurants along the way, such as the Forest restaurant at Hohenseelbachskopf or the Peterszeche Mine Tunnel and Shelter.

What is the typical duration for a road cycling tour in this area?

Tour durations vary significantly based on the route's length and difficulty, as well as your personal pace. Many moderate routes, like the Heimhof Theater – Steinches Mill loop from Daaden (55.2 km), can take around 2.5 hours. Shorter, easier routes might be completed in under 1.5 hours, while longer, more challenging tours could extend to 3 hours or more.

Are there any routes that offer panoramic views?

Yes, the hilly terrain of the Westerwald-Sieg region provides numerous opportunities for panoramic views. The View of the Siebengebirge – Elkenrother Weiher loop from Weitefeld is specifically named for its vistas, including glimpses of the distant Siebengebirge. Many routes also ascend to points where you can enjoy expansive views over the surrounding forests and valleys.

Can I find routes that are suitable for a family outing with older children?

While road cycling routes are generally geared towards individual or group cycling, some of the easier and moderate routes with less traffic and gentler gradients could be suitable for families with older, experienced children. Look for routes described as 'easy' or those that stick to quieter roads through meadows and villages for a more relaxed family experience.

Are there any specific routes that pass through charming villages?

Many routes in the Niederdreisbach area weave through the region's idyllic villages. The Heimhof Theater – Steinches Mill loop from Daaden, for example, leads through charming villages and wooded areas, offering a glimpse into local life and architecture.
